Facebook Conversion API Action

Last updated on 23 Aug, 2025

Through the Facebook Conversions API workflow action, advertisers can transmit web events directly to Facebook from their servers. This feature bypasses the third-party block enforced by IOS as well as Chrome and Adblocker, too.

Connection Type

Select the kind you'd like to use for these Facebook API, keep in mind this will define the information you need to fill out.

undefined

Select an Event Type, here you'll have two options:

undefined
  • Funnel Events: These events are sent from a web server to record when the user interacts with it.

  • Lead Events: These events are triggered when a Lead moves across the pipeline stages.

Access Token

To add an Access Token to your workflow for Facebook's Conversion API, begin by navigating to the Facebook Business Manager section within your Facebook account settings. Next, select Generate Access Token within the Conversion API category and copy the token. Finally, paste the token into the designated 'Access Token' field in your workflow.

undefined

If the business page is new, it may be necessary to set up Social issue, electoral, or political ads settings to access the token. This process may require confirmation of identity.

Pixel ID

To set up the Pixel ID for Facebook Conversion API in your workflow, go to the Facebook Business Manager's settings and copy the ID under the detail section. Then, paste the ID into the designated Pixel ID field in your workflow.

undefined

Facebook Event Name

Next, in the Facebook Event Name section, select the appropriate event name from the available options. You can select from items such as contact, lead, add payment info, and more!

undefined

Value

In the Value field, insert the value of the event name selected above. This will create the lead value based on your preferences.

undefined

Currency

Add the appropriate currency type in the provided Currency field. The system will automatically set the currency type to USD, but you can change this to your country's preference.

undefined

Test Code

To test the workflow, go back to the Facebook Business Manager account and click on Data Sources, then find the Pixel you have created. Copy the test code in the test event and paste it into the Test Code field.

undefined

Once testing is complete, delete the test code from the field and save the workflow.
